Organic Valerian Root (Valeriana officinalis) – ½ lb Bag
Dried Botanical Root for Teas, Tonics & Traditional Herbal Use
Valerian root, sourced from the Valeriana officinalis plant, is a pungent and earthy botanical traditionally used in herbal preparations. Recognized for its distinctive aroma and historical usage in evening teas and infusions, valerian has long held a place in folk herbalism around the world.
This root is carefully cut and sifted for easy brewing. It pairs well with herbs like chamomile, lemon balm, passionflower, or skullcap in herbal blends and botanical recipes.
Suggested Uses:
- Use 1–2 teaspoons of dried valerian root per cup of water
- Simmer gently for 10–15 minutes and strain before serving
- Combine with complementary herbs in loose-leaf tea blends
- Can be incorporated into tinctures or other botanical preparations
